Transaction 259a07511963a425136d770c07b22cbdb1660c95673852ab80905e23c31378dc

3 Input
2 Outputs
  • 259a07511963a425136d770c07b22cbdb1660c95673852ab80905e23c31378dc:0
  • value  4680336
    address  1Jpk9rYE7RxELbYkoSFS17W8YXCRfywvbP
  • 259a07511963a425136d770c07b22cbdb1660c95673852ab80905e23c31378dc:1
  • value  995410
    address  14ELTxkz4ntLJncGJNXCZGFaMhKXTV6F4d